Job Title: Project Engineer (Automotive Chassis)

Location: Surrey (Hybrid Working)

Contract Type: 6-Month Initial Contract

Company Overview: We are working with a forward-thinking company dedicated to innovation and excellence in the automotive industry. We are seeking a highly skilled Project Engineer with a mechanical background and expertise in automotive chassis. This role offers a unique opportunity to work on cutting-edge projects and collaborate with a diverse range of stakeholders.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Manage and lead mechanical design projects, specifically focusing on automotive chassis, ensuring all technical and testing specifications are met.
  • Utilize your expertise in Design Failure Mode and Effects Analysis (DFMEA) and Design for Manufacturing (DFM) to improve product development and reliability.
  • Apply Catia design to oversee mechanical designs.
  • Translate complex technologies into clear and actionable technical and testing specifications.
  • Collaborate effectively with internal teams and external stakeholders, including a testing team based in Spain.
  • Use Matlab and Excel for data analysis, project support, and process optimization.
  • Proactively identify and resolve technical challenges to ensure projects are completed on time and within budget.

Required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in Mechanical Engineering or a related field.
  • Proven experience in mechanical design, with a strong understanding of DFMEA and DFM.
  • Proficiency in Catia design software.
  • Strong technical and analytical skills, with experience in Matlab and Excel.
  • Excellent communication and collaboration skills to work effectively with diverse teams and stakeholders.
  • Demonstrated proactive approach to problem-solving and project management.
  • Specific experience in automotive chassis design and engineering.

What We Offer:

  • An initial 6-month contract with the potential for extension based on project needs and performance.
  • A hybrid working environment, offering flexibility and work-life balance.
  • The opportunity to work on innovative automotive projects with a talented and dedicated team.
